We are a well-established and growing company specializing in architectural metals and glass, focusing on high-quality processing and installation for commercial, residential, and industrial projects. Our team is dedicated to craftsmanship, safety, and delivering excellence in every job.
Job Overview:
We are currently seeking a motivated and detail-oriented junior foreman to join our team. This is an excellent opportunity for someone with experience in the metal and glass industry who wants to transition into a leadership role. You will work closely with senior foremen, project managers, and installation teams to ensure that projects are completed safely, on time, and to our high standards.
Key Responsibilities:

  • Assist in supervising workers during processing.
  • Coordinate daily tasks according to project plans and schedules.
  • Ensure compliance with safety procedures and company standards at all times.
  • Communicate effectively with team members, subcontractors, and management.
  • Assist in monitoring on-site inventory and materials.
  • Support quality control and final inspections.
  • Learn and develop under the mentorship of seniors.
  • Maintain high standards of quality control in all aspects of metal and glass processing.
  • Conduct inspections at various stages of the project to ensure work meets company and client specifications.
  • Read and interpret workshop drawings, plans, and technical documentation.
  • Assist in monitoring progress on the construction site, managing schedules, and coordinating material deliveries.
    Qualifications:
  • 10+ years of experience in the metal and glass industry (installation or processing).
  • Strong understanding of construction tools, materials, and techniques.
  • Leadership potential with good communication and organizational skills.
  • Ability to read and interpret workshop drawings and plans.
  • Valid driver's license and reliable transportation.
  • SST certification is a plus (or willingness to obtain it).
